The 2019-2020 Advanced Band audition includes:

  • Major scales and the chromatic scale - memorized
  • Audition Excerpt from 2020 CBDA All State Audition material (Junior high) - not memorized (see list of excerpts later on this page; buy the book so you can find the excerpt)
  • Sight-reading

Audition Scales

All 12 major scales for your instruments (from this scale page), and the chromatic scale, memorized, played as written with the metronome set to at least 92 to the quarter note. Print out the pages for your instrument for practice.

NOTE: One octave scales are listed under "Concert Band." Two octave scales are listed under "Symphonic Band." Play at least one octave, as listed under "Concert Band." Only attempt two octaves if you can play both octaves smoothly and in time with the metronome at 92 to the quarter note. Those who can play two octaves well get extra points.

For the chromatic scale, play at least one octave (from this scale page). If you can play another octave well, play two octaves. Slur all notes in chromatic scale. Chromatic scale should be memorized and played as written on the scale sheet with the metronome, at least 92 to the quarter note.
